Transaction 51d5debc2fea7cddb76a3541aee92ed73bdbcdefa2142ede5ea91dc006db4e5f
1 Input
1 Output
-
51d5debc2fea7cddb76a3541aee92ed73bdbcdefa2142ede5ea91dc006db4e5f:0
- value
- 996290
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ab083722105b138382233148af1b7bd0d690a7b
- address
- tb1q92cgxu3pqkcnswpzxv2g4udhh5xkjznm4867ce